Alexey Rybalchenko bbadf09aad FairMQ: Extend Multipart and messaging API
- Extend the multipart API to allow sending vectors of messages or helper
   thin wrapper FairMQParts. See example in examples/MQ/8-multipart.
 - NewMessage() can be used in devices instead of
   fTransportFactory->CreateMessage().
   Possible arguments remain unchanged (no args, size or data+size).
 - Send()/Receive() methods can be used in devices instead of
   fChannels.at("chan").at(i).Send()/Receive():
   Send(msg, "chan", i = 0), Receive(msg, "chan", i = 0).
 - Use the new methods in MQ examples and tests.
 - No breaking changes, but FAIRMQ_INTERFACE_VERSION is incremented to 3
   to allow to check for new methods.

#include <boost/thread.hpp>
#include <boost/bind.hpp>
#include "FairMQExample8Sink.h"
#include "FairMQLogger.h"
using namespace std;
struct Ex8Header {
int32_t stopFlag;
};
FairMQExample8Sink::FairMQExample8Sink()
{
}
void FairMQExample8Sink::Run()
{
while (CheckCurrentState(RUNNING))
{
FairMQParts parts;
if (Receive(parts, "data-in") >= 0)
{
Ex8Header header;
header.stopFlag = (static_cast<Ex8Header*>(parts.At(0).GetData()))->stopFlag;
LOG(INFO) << "Received header with stopFlag: " << header.stopFlag;
LOG(INFO) << "Received body of size: " << parts.At(1).GetSize();
if (header.stopFlag == 1)
{
LOG(INFO) << "Flag is 0, exiting Run()";
break;
}
}
}
}
FairMQExample8Sink::~FairMQExample8Sink()
{
}
